Travel in Time with Havana Cafe
By: Mercedes Ramos | Photos: José Meriño
Crossing the threshold of the Havana Café's large party space is like going back in time. Its peculiar atmosphere recalls the 1950's.
The welcome by an impressive vintage Chevy convertible, a 57 Buick, a two-seater Yak 18 airplane and a 1947 Harley Davidson bike, as well as many other objects of the same period and photos of artists and relevant historic events make this place a unique spot in Cuba that all visitors to the capital should know.
Each night the Havana Cafe introduces the Havana Jazz Band, vocal quartets, singers and other contemporary music bands and dancers. Everything is prepared to give you a first class show. Fridays are especially arranged for the presentation of internationally renowned Cuban artists
